SugarSync already available for Symbian S60 Devices

SugarSync is bringing its file synchronization service, back-ups and more to the well known S60 Symbian platform. Available for free download, SugarSync application allows users to easily access, manage and share all your personal content at any time. We can store many types of files to SugarSync account, including documents and photos, and even edit them on the road if an appropriate document editor is installed on our team.

SugarSync for Symbian is available for download directly from www.sugarsync.com / symbian, and works only on phones with Symbian S60 5th edition. The service itself comes with 2GB of free storage and 30GB plans partit costing U.S. $ 4.99 per month.

Joined the Symbian client, SugarSync has also improved its user interface on the web, making it much easier to access, manage, and synchronize files shared. The updated website provides easy and quick access to common functions such as sharing a folder, send a file, create a public link, upload and view pictures and play music files streamed from SugarSync.

It is worth mentioning also that apart from Symbian, SugarSync is available in many other mobile platforms, such as IOS, Android, BlackBerry and Windows Mobile.
